Over 400 people had tested positive for Covid-19 the past week in Maldives
Health Protection Agency (HPA) disclosed on Monday that 405 people had tested positive for Covid from June 12 to June 18. Two hundred and thirty one of those people were from Male’ while 95 people were from various administrative islands. The remaining 79 people had contracted it from other, unspecified means.
The total number of confirmed Covid cases in Maldives is now at 180,384. Covid fatalities also reached 300 the past week.
HPA’s statistics also show that 17 people required in patient treatment for Covid in that period.
Internal Doctor at Indira Gandhi Memorial Hospital (IGMH) Mohamed Ali had raised concerns an increase noticed in patients being admitted for other medical reasons testing positive for Covid-19. He said this showed that Covid was increasing within the community.
“People visiting patients in hospitals have to be very careful now. It is best to only visit the hospital when absolutely necessary,” he said.
Even though the cases have increased, no further restrictive measures are being put in place. However, HPA urges everyone to wear masks in public again, even though it is not mandatory.
